In many families there are certain traditions that have been practiced from many generations. In my family cooking is a really important tradition. My dad, especially, really loves cooking and having special traditions. The recipes he has are some of his own, but some are from his grandparents. Some of his recipes include brisket, ribs, deer steak, fish, turkey, and turkey soup. 

My dad’s recipes are always from our own harvests. He takes pride in his recipes and always tries new things. His recipes are really simple and he uses many seasonings. These seasonings are onion powder, garlic powder, salt, pepper, paprika, basil, and many others. Using family  recipes is important because these recipes can teach you about your past relatives. You can pass them down from generations to generations, and share them with your kids or even grandchildren. 

My family always tries our best to bring everyone together. When we go on family vacations, we always make an effort to keep the traditions of cooking family foods and gathering together to eat it. We always have huge buffets of food and sometimes there’s even new types of foods. It is really important to keep these traditions, so that you can be close to your family.
